So, Cursa, right? It's this intriguing 2025 adventure flick that's got a certain rawness to it. The pacing feels deliberate, allowing you to soak in the atmosphere—think wide landscapes and a sense of exploration. The director remains anonymous, which adds to its mystique, but the practical effects here stand out. They’ve really committed to tangible artistry rather than relying too heavily on CGI. The performances are solid, though some might find them a bit understated. What’s distinctive is its quieter tone; it leans more into the emotional journey than typical adventure tropes. It’s got a vibe that feels different in today’s cinema landscape, an exploration of self amid grand adventures. Worth a look for those curious about the genre’s edges.
